Détails du cours
- Introduction to Electric Aircraft Data Science: Fundamentals of data science, electric aircraft, and the intersection of these two fields.
- Data Collection and Management: Techniques for gathering, cleaning, and storing data from electric aircraft systems.
- Data Analysis and Visualization: Methods for analyzing and visualizing electric aircraft data, including statistical analysis and data visualization tools.
- Machine Learning for Electric Aircraft: Overview of machine learning techniques and how they can be applied to electric aircraft data to improve performance and efficiency.
- Electric Propulsion Systems: Deep dive into the electric propulsion systems used in electric aircraft and the data generated by these systems.
- Battery Management Systems: Examination of battery management systems and the role they play in electric aircraft, including data analysis and optimization.
- Safety and Security in Electric Aircraft Data Science: Exploration of the safety and security concerns related to electric aircraft data science and best practices for ensuring data privacy and security.
- Regulations and Standards: Overview of the regulations and standards that apply to electric aircraft data science, including data privacy and security regulations.
- Future Trends in Electric Aircraft Data Science: Examination of the future trends and developments in electric aircraft data science, including the role of artificial intelligence and machine learning in this field.
